Jamia Millia Islamia MSc student awarded scholarship by 6 US universities

Jamia Millia Islamia (JMI) Alumna Uzma Khan, who completed her MSc Electronics course from Department of Applied Sciences, Faculty of Engineering and Technology, Jamia in 2021, has received offers to do fully funded PhD from six prestigious US universities. The university said it applied for 100 percent scholarships at nine US universities and received offers from six. His area of ​​research will be ‘underwater wireless communication and signal processing’.

Uzma was offered 100 percent tuition fee waiver along with a monthly stipend for an on-campus job of research and teaching assistant at six US universities – Lehigh University, University of Cincinnati, University of Maryland in Baltimore County, SUNY (State University of the University) Is. New York) University at Buffalo, SUNY Albany and New Hampshire.

Uzma has chosen Leh University and will be joining in August 2022. He has also been given a lump sum transfer allowance by the university. “I am joining Lehigh University because my academic qualifications and research interest match perfectly with those of my potential supervisor,” she said.

The wireless and signal processing lab she is going to join is conducting cutting-edge research on current and future technologies and what would be best suited for her research area which is underwater wireless communication and signal processing, she explained.

She was able to apply to US universities after getting good marks in IELTS and GRE. After sending e-mails to professors with whom her research interest coincides, she subsequently approved a technical interview with a committee composed of members of the laboratory/department to which she wished to be admitted.

Uzma has also topped her class during her master’s studies at Jamia and for this she will be awarded a gold medal at the upcoming convocation. He has also received a provisional offer for Inspire Fellowship by DST, Ministry of Science and Technology. Earlier, he was hired as a systems engineer in TCS and Infosys, but he decided not to join as his interest lies in research.
